Warehouse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| You can likely clean up the spill yourself with a wet/dry vacuum and some towels. |
| Large water spill (over 100 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| You’ll need specialized equipment and expertise to extract water and dry surfaces effectively. |
| Visible signs of mold or mildew | No | Yes | Mold and mildew need specialized equipment and techniques to remove safely and effectively. |
| Structural damage or warping | No | Yes | Structural damage needs specialized expertise and equipment to assess and repair safely. |
| Uncertain about the extent of damage | No | Yes | Our team can assess the situation and provide a clear plan to address the damage and prevent further issues. |

Warehouse Water Damage Restoration Cost in North Salt Lake, UT
The cost of Warehouse Water Damage Restoration in North Salt Lake, UT,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, and equipment needed |
| Structural Dr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of construction, and equipment needed |
| Mold Remediation |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old, and equipment needed |
| Final Inspection and Cleaning |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and type of cleaning required |
